//! # Whisper.apr
//!
//! WASM-first automatic speech recognition engine implementing OpenAI's Whisper architecture.
//!
//! ## Overview
//!
//! Whisper.apr is designed from inception for WASM deployment via `wasm32-unknown-unknown`,
//! leveraging Rust's superior WASM toolchain for:
//! - 30-40% smaller binary sizes through tree-shaking
//! - Native WASM SIMD 128-bit intrinsics without Emscripten overhead
//! - Zero-copy audio buffer handling via shared memory
//!
//! ## Quick Start
//!
//! ```rust,ignore
//! use whisper_apr::{WhisperApr, TranscribeOptions};
//!
//! let whisper = WhisperApr::load("base.apr")?;
//! let result = whisper.transcribe(&audio_samples, TranscribeOptions::default())?;
//! println!("{}", result.text);
//! ```
//!
//! ## Features
//!
//! - `std` (default): Standard library support
//! - `wasm`: WASM bindings via wasm-bindgen
//! - `simd`: SIMD acceleration via trueno
//! - `tracing`: Performance tracing via renacer
